Saudi Arabia Smart Wearable ECG Monitors Market Overview

  • The Saudi Arabia Smart Wearable ECG Monitors Market is valued at USD 95 million, based on a five-year historical analysis. This growth is primarily driven by the increasing prevalence of cardiovascular diseases, rising health awareness among consumers, and advancements in wearable technology that enable continuous health monitoring. The integration of artificial intelligence and mobile applications has further enhanced the functionality and appeal of these devices.
  • Key cities such as Riyadh, Jeddah, and Dammam dominate the market due to their advanced healthcare infrastructure, high population density, and increasing disposable income among residents. The urban population's growing interest in fitness and preventive healthcare, combined with the widespread adoption of digital health solutions, has also contributed to the demand for smart wearable ECG monitors in these regions.
  • The Telemedicine Regulations, 2020 issued by the Saudi Ministry of Health, established operational standards for remote healthcare delivery, including the use of wearable devices for patient monitoring. These regulations require healthcare providers to ensure data privacy, obtain patient consent, and comply with technical standards for telehealth platforms, thereby promoting the adoption of smart wearable ECG monitors across the country.

Saudi Arabia Smart Wearable ECG Monitors Market Segmentation

By Type:The market is segmented into various types of smart wearable ECG monitors, including Continuous ECG Monitors, Patch ECG Monitors, Smartwatches with ECG Functionality, Wearable ECG Monitors for Children, and Others. Continuous ECG Monitors are gaining traction due to their ability to provide real-time data for arrhythmia detection and chronic disease management, while Smartwatches with ECG functionality are popular among fitness enthusiasts and the general population for their convenience, integration with mobile health apps, and multi-functional health tracking capabilities.

Saudi Arabia Smart Wearable ECG Monitors Market segmentation by Type.

By End-User:The end-user segmentation includes Hospitals, Home Care Settings, Fitness Centers, Telehealth Providers, and Others. Hospitals are the primary users due to the need for continuous patient monitoring and integration with electronic health records, while Home Care Settings are increasingly adopting these devices for chronic disease management, remote patient monitoring, and preventive care. Fitness Centers and Telehealth Providers are also expanding their use of wearable ECG monitors to support wellness programs and virtual care delivery.

Saudi Arabia Smart Wearable ECG Monitors Market Industry Analysis

Growth Drivers

  • Increasing Prevalence of Cardiovascular Diseases:The World Health Organization reported that cardiovascular diseases (CVDs) account for approximately 37% of all deaths in Saudi Arabia, with over 43,000 fatalities annually. This alarming statistic drives the demand for smart wearable ECG monitors, as early detection and continuous monitoring are crucial for managing heart health. The rising incidence of hypertension and diabetes, which are significant risk factors for CVDs, further emphasizes the need for effective monitoring solutions in the region.
  • Rising Health Awareness Among Consumers:A survey conducted by the Saudi Ministry of Health indicated that 68% of the population is increasingly aware of health issues, particularly heart-related conditions. This growing health consciousness is leading to a surge in demand for wearable ECG monitors, as consumers seek proactive health management tools. The increasing availability of health information through digital platforms is also contributing to this trend, encouraging individuals to invest in personal health monitoring devices.
  • Technological Advancements in Wearable Devices:The Saudi Arabian market is witnessing rapid technological advancements in wearable ECG monitors, with features such as real-time data analytics and mobile app integration. According to a report by the Saudi Communications and Information Technology Commission, the wearable technology sector is expected to grow by 17% annually. These innovations enhance user experience and accuracy, making ECG monitors more appealing to consumers and healthcare providers alike, thus driving market growth.

Market Challenges

  • High Cost of Advanced ECG Monitors:The average price of advanced ECG monitors in Saudi Arabia ranges from SAR 1,600 to SAR 5,500, which can be prohibitive for many consumers. This high cost limits accessibility, particularly among lower-income populations. Additionally, the lack of insurance coverage for such devices further exacerbates the issue, hindering widespread adoption and limiting the market's growth potential in the region.
  • Limited Consumer Awareness About ECG Wearables:Despite the increasing prevalence of cardiovascular diseases, consumer awareness regarding the benefits of ECG wearables remains low. A study by the Saudi Health Council found that only 32% of the population is familiar with ECG monitoring technology. This lack of awareness poses a significant challenge for manufacturers and healthcare providers, as it hampers efforts to promote these devices as essential health management tools.

Saudi Arabia Smart Wearable ECG Monitors Market Future Outlook

The future of the smart wearable ECG monitors market in Saudi Arabia appears promising, driven by technological innovations and a shift towards preventive healthcare. As telehealth services expand, more consumers will likely embrace remote monitoring solutions. Additionally, collaborations between technology firms and healthcare providers will enhance product offerings, making ECG monitors more accessible. The increasing demand for personalized health solutions will further propel market growth, as consumers seek tailored approaches to managing their cardiovascular health.

Market Opportunities

  • Expansion of Telehealth Services:The Saudi government aims to increase telehealth services, with a target of 60% of healthcare consultations being conducted remotely in future. This initiative presents a significant opportunity for smart wearable ECG monitors, as they can facilitate remote patient monitoring and enhance healthcare delivery, ultimately improving patient outcomes and reducing healthcare costs.
  • Development of Affordable ECG Monitoring Solutions:There is a growing demand for cost-effective ECG monitoring solutions in Saudi Arabia, particularly among lower-income populations. By focusing on developing affordable devices, manufacturers can tap into this underserved market segment, potentially increasing adoption rates and contributing to better health outcomes across diverse demographics.
